Question: Introduction: In this section, briefly describe the event that you encountered (or observed) that made you decide to write your paper on this topic. Then, in a few sentences explain the purpose and general scope of your paper. The purpose should include: (a) to provide a brief background of research and theory on the topic; (b) to illustrate the topic by reviewing three different journal articles (research reports), each of which represent a different social science; and (c) to provide an integrative summary.

Background: In this section, provide a brief overview of the the research or theory relating to this topic. It is fine to utilize the Handbook of Homelessness for this purpose and, if you do, then cite it in the text and include it as one of your references.

Illustration of the Topic: Introduce this section by briefly explaining that you will illustrate the topic by reviewing three different journal articles (research reports), each of which represent a different social science.

Psychology: In your own words, briefly review the article that you obtained.

Sociology: In your own words, briefly review the article that you obtained.

Human Rights: In your own words, briefly review the article that you obtained.

Integrative Summary: In your integrative summary, you should attempt to show how the research from the different social sciences complement one another in illustrating or explaining the problem that you are addressing in the paper. In your attempt to integrate, you should make use of ecological models that we have covered in this course, as well as associated principles (i.e., principle of reciprocal determinism, principle of equifinality, principle of multifinality, and so on).

References: Provide the reference for each and every work cited in your paper.
